Wedding trip to Italian

View through Europeana Collections
Wedding trip to Italian Conchita Velasco, Tony Russell, Alberto Farnese, Luigi De Filippo, Toni Ucci, Ferruccio Amendola, Anna Mach, Renzo Montagnani, Antonio, directed by Mario Amendola. General organizer: Roberto Moretti, Italian-Spanish co-production Frine film Roma, Arturo Gonzales Madrid, distribution: Selecta film s.r.l., Eastmancolor, panoramic screen
